Maplin

Maplin is an electronics retailer located in the UK that focuses on offering enthusiasts with the equipment they need to create electronic projects. Maplin offers a broad assortment of products, including chargers, batteries and accessories. The range of products also includes lighting and audio equipment. The website also has educational videos and product information that help consumers through the process of choosing the best product.

In 1972 two electronics enthusiasts became frustrated with the difficulty of getting the right parts for their electronic projects. They started by creating an electronic component catalog for fellow geeks, and then sold them via mail-order. As the company increased, the company widened its offering to include a full range of home-built electronic project kits. The rise of home computers spawned by manufacturers like Sinclair, Commodore International, and Atari gave new opportunities to Maplin to design electronic projects suitable for its customers. Maplin was famous for its 217 stores in the UK and was among the most renowned electronic merchandise retailers.

Despite its popularity, Maplin fell into administration in June 2018. Its administrators, PricewaterhouseCoopers, are expected to close all the company's stores and cut jobs, with some employees being given as little as one day's notice. The collapse of Maplin is similar to the demise of Toys R Us, another well-known British retailer.

Maplin's demise was not a shock but the company could have avoided it if they had focused on their core audience. It was too focused on advertising Internet of Things gadgets - an idea that hasn't been as successful as it would have liked. This is a lesson every business should learn if they are looking to succeed in the digital age.

Euronics

There are a variety of online electronic stores in the UK that offer fantastic deals on a broad range of products. You can purchase anything from laptops and tablet computers to cameras and smartwatches. Some of these sites offer refurbished electronics. Although they might not be as well-made as newer models however, they can save you a lot of money.

Euronics, founded in 1990, is a network of independent electrical retailers. Each store in the Euronics network sells top-of-the-line products at affordable prices. The marketplace model encourages competition, which translates into price competition for customers. The network also puts sustainability first and provides detailed information on energy efficiency.

The Euronics network is comprised of 11,000 electrical retailers across 30 European countries. This gives the Euronics group enormous buying power, allowing them to negotiate great discounts on the top appliances. Despite this, each member store remains small enough to pay attention to its customers. Most are family-owned businesses that have been operating for a number of generations. They are able to provide unbeatable expertise in their products and provide rapid, efficient service following the sale.
